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00252658 989784641 5182077 03669346 8960
968 239
968 239
36407 5235037267 88 93199218
All about undefined
Interested in learning more?
968 239
36407 5235037267 88 93199218
See more
24 867663013 31878581846
90720739 1618264 82366 87023537
See more
331890 44667 5960838454
35 26463748 02136610
See more